The Pinellas Trail is indeed a biker's paradise! The trail is 47 miles long, connecting St Petersburg with the rest of Pinellas County. It winds it's way up the county, through community after community all the way to Tarpon Springs, offering bikers, joggers and hikers a wonderful place to safely enjoy the Florida Sunshine without worrying about traffic!

In fact the Pinellas Trail is the longest urban linear trail in the entire eastern United States!!! Something to consider if you enjoy walking or biking! This was built along an abandoned railroad corridor. Development began in December 1990 and has grown over the years to take up 47 miles. Along the way you will find benches to rest as well as water fountains and rest areas!
